Polymist® F284 is a white micronized PTFE powder composed of discrete particles.
Available worldwide, Polymist® F284 is a medium molecular weight grade with excellent thermal stability, designed for use in critical high temperature engineering and high perfomance polymers.
As with all Polymist® micronized powders, F284 offers excellent chemical and temperature resitence, low surface energy, low coeffcient of friction and good dispersion ability.
Main features of Polymist® F284 are:
- Better wear resistance
- Increased pressure x velocity (PV) limits
- Reduced friction
- Improved stick-slip response
- Improved mold release

Polymist® F5A is a white PTFE micronized powder PTFE micronized powder composed of discrete particles. Designed for use in critical engineering and high-end performance elastomers and coatings, Polymist® F5A will improved abrasion and tear resistance as well as non-stick properties, mar and abrasion resistance.
Polymist® F5A can also be used in plastics application to improved wear resistance and low coefficient of friction or in lubricants for its thickening effect, lubricity, improved corrosion and temperature resistance.
Main features of Polymist® F5A are:
- Improved lubricity, abrasion, scratch and rub resistance
- Increased (hot) tear strength
- Better flex life
- Increased slip and surface lubricity
- Reduced blocking
- Better chemical resistance
- Increased temperature resistance
- Gloss retention

Polymist® F5A EX is a white PTFE micronized powder PTFE micronized powder composed of discrete particles. Designed for use in critical engineering and high end performance plastics applications, Polymist® F5A EX will improve wear resistance and reduce coefficient of friction.
Main features of Polymist® F5A EX are:
- Better wear resistance
- Increased pressure x velocity (PV) limits
- Reduced friction
- Improved stick-slip response
- Improved mold release

Polymist® XPP 511 is a medium MW grade of micronized PTFE with coarse particle size and excellent thermal stability.
It is designed for use in critical, high temperature engineering and high performance polymers to provide improved wear resistance and low coeffcient of friction.
Main features of Polymist® XPP 511 are:
- Better wear resistance
- Increased pressure x velocity (PV) limits
- Reduced friction
- Improved stick-slip response
- Improved mold release

Polymist® XPP 552 is a white PTFE micronized powder composed of discrete particles.
Designed for use in critical engineering and high end performance Coatings and Inks, Polymist® XPP 552 will improve non-stick properties, mar and abrasion resistance as well as slip and rub resistance.
Main Polymist® XPP 552 features are:
- Improved abrasion, scratch and rub resistance
- Increased slip and surface lubricity
- Reduced blocking
- Better chemical resistance
- Increased temperature resistance
- Gloss retention
